During the procedure, four to six small incisions are made in the belly (similar to laparoscopic surgery) to lift the prolapsed organ and secure it with graph material. Studies show that five years after surgery women who undergo a sacrocolpopexy enjoy a 95 to 98 percent success rate. WebOct 9, 2016 · The bladder is connected through nerves to the brain via the spine. Through these nerves, the bladder sends signals to the brain telling it that it is full and needs to empty. When we decide to go to the toilet, the brain sends signals back to the pelvic floor muscles telling them to relax.
